No one enters marriage thinking, “I hope we get divorced.” Everyone wants their marriage to survive, but even more than that, we want our marriages to thrive. A thriving marriage is not built by moments though, it is built by making the right decisions moment by moment.
It Takes Two – Thrive
A thriving marriage does not depend on moments, it is decided moment by moment.
